Location Overview

Cboe HQ is located in the historic Old Post Office district, it's a landmark that blends classic architecture with modern amenities. The building features expansive spaces with high ceilings and large windows, offering an abundance of natural light and panoramic views of the city skyline and the Chicago River.

With its prime location in the heart of downtown, the OPO Building provides easy access to major transportation hubs, including Union Station and multiple CTA lines, making it convenient for commuters. The building is home to a variety of amenities, including restaurants, a fitness center, and collaborative workspaces, creating a vibrant and dynamic work environment in one of Chicago's most iconic areas.

The Senior Marketing Specialist, Institutional is the team's go-to executor, a versatile, hands-on marketer who makes sure the work gets done and gets done well. The role supports the full institutional marketing program across derivatives, Data Vantage, equities, and FX, spanning web, channels, content, events, reporting, and operations, and holds every detail to a high standard. It suits a detail-driven marketer who can juggle many competing workstreams at once and deliver consistently, on brand, and on schedule.

Key Responsibilities
  • Own the team's web presence, keeping institutional product pages accurate, current, and aligned with the latest messaging.
  • Manage projects with the execution teams that deliver email, social, paid media, and other channels, keeping deliverables on scope and on schedule.
  • Build and maintain the team's reporting and dashboards, providing the accurate, timely performance data the team makes decisions on.
  • Own the operational backbone of the team: marketing calendars, asset libraries, and project trackers that keep the work organized and on track.
  • Produce content from brief to publication, accountable for deadline, quality, and brand consistency.
  • Manage events and the full lead lifecycle, from capture through CRM to follow-up, converting attendance into qualified leads.
  • Own the compliance and legal review pipeline, getting content approved and live without bottlenecks.
  • Coordinate agencies and contractors, accountable for scope, schedule, and quality.
  • Step in across any business line or program as priorities require, picking up whatever the team needs to ship.


Required Qualifications
  • 5+ years of B2B marketing experience; financial services is a plus.
  • Demonstrated ownership of marketing channels or programs end to end, with accountability for their performance.
  • Strong project management skills, with the ability to run several workstreams at once and hold them to a standard.
  • Excellent writing and editing skills.
  • Experience running multi-channel campaigns.
  • Detail-oriented and organized, with strong follow-through.
  • Comfort owning data and reporting that others rely on.


Preferred Qualifications
  • Familiarity with capital markets, derivatives, market data, or FX.
  • Experience with Salesforce, marketing automation (Marketo, Pardot, or HubSpot), CMS, social management, and analytics tools.
  • Event marketing experience.

About Chicago Board Options Exchange

The Chicago Board Options Exchange, located at 433 West Van Buren Street in Chicago, is the largest U.S. options exchange with an annual trading volume of around 1.27 billion at the end of 2014. CBOE offers options on over 2,200 companies, 22 stock indices, and 140 exchange-traded funds. The Chicago Board of Trade established the Chicago Board Options Exchange in 1973. The first exchange to list standardized, exchange-traded stock options began its first day of trading on April 26, 1973, in celebration of the 125th birthday of the Chicago Board of Trade. The CBOE is regulated by the Securities and Exchange Commission and owned by Cboe Global Markets.
